* [PATCH] CI: bump actions/checkout from 4 to 5 for rust-analysis job

GitHub Actions started complaining about use of Node.js 20 and I was
wondering why only one job uses actions/checkout@v4, while everybody
else already uses actions/checkout@v5.  It turns out that it is a
semantic mismerge between e75cd059 (ci: check formatting of our Rust
code, 2025-10-15) that added a new use of actions/checkout@v4 that
happened very close to another change 63541ed9 (build(deps): bump
actions/checkout from 4 to 5, 2025-10-16) that updated all uses of
actions/checkout@v4 to use actions/checkout@v5.

Update the leftover and the last use of actions/checkout@v4 to use
actions/checkout@v5 to help ourselves to move away from Node.js 20.
